Editing pages

Editing a page is easy - click on the 'edit' link at the top of the page. Wiki pages are written in a markup language similar to HTML or Latex (but simpler). It's easy to learn by diving into other people's pages, and you can also see For Editors and Editing. If you make a mistake it can easily be reverted (by you or any other user) at any time, so be bold!

Creating pages

The easiest way to create a new page is to search for the page title. Assuming it doesn't already exist, you will be presented with a link to create it. Don't feel obliged to make it a complete page right away -- you can flag a draft page as a Stub by putting the text {{stub}} near the bottom of the page to automatically add it to the category of stubs. To keep the wiki useful please also categorize your pages according to the available categories. For more information, see Starting a new page.
